Factors to Consider Before You buy electric mobility scooter an Electric Mobility Scooter

A mobility scooter can be a great solution for people who struggle to climb steps or navigating the terrain. It is important to take into consideration several factors before purchasing an electric scooter.

First, you must determine the way you intend to use it. If you intend to take it on a long trip then you require a scooter that has a large range of operation and battery performance.

Size

Mobility scooters enable people who have trouble walking to leave the house without having to rely on family, friends or strangers. This independence is crucial for the mental health of those with mobility issues, who often feel isolated and unable to live the lives they would like to. Having the ability to shop and do errands on their own can boost confidence and provides an opportunity to take charge of their lives and not feel as if they are a burden to the people around them.

If you are in the market for a new electric mobility scooter, there are a lot of things to consider. The scooter's size, speed and power are vital. The purpose of the scooter's use, whether outdoors or indoors is important. Three-wheeled Scooters are smaller in turning radius and are therefore better suited to indoor use. Four-wheeled Scooters are more stable, and can handle outdoor terrain.

There are many various types of scooters on the market, from small, lightweight models to large luxury models. They can be folded and stored in the trunk of your car. These scooters are usually more expensive than other models, however they are smaller because they don't need to be taken apart. Luxury scooters offer a larger and more comfortable ride. Some even come with captain's seats or a high back chair. These types of scooters are generally more expensive than folding models, however they're still cheaper than all-terrain models.

The speed of the scooter is crucial because it can affect the distance a person can travel in one charge. Most travel-sized scooters have top speeds between 3 and 5 miles per hour, whereas larger heavy-duty models may be able to reach 10 or more miles per hour.

Most scooters come with padding on the seat, which is either filled with foam (for a more comfortable ride) or air-filled (for more comfortable riding). Some premium models even have a swivel feature, which makes it easier to take the scooter.

Weight

Weight is an important aspect to consider when purchasing an mobility device. The weight of the scooter can be a significant factor in determining whether it is capable of maneuvering across rough terrain or travel long distances in one charge. Mobility scooters come in a wide range of weight capacities to suit every user's requirements. The battery is the most heavy part of a scooter, and can add a few pounds to the overall weight.

The weight of mobility scooters is determined by the shape and size of its frame. The frame of a scooter could be made of aluminum or steel, and it is important to choose the type that best buy mobility scooters fits your needs. While lightweight frames make it easier to maneuver and handle heavier frames are more stable and have a higher weight capacity.

When choosing the right mobility device, speed is an additional aspect to take into consideration. Most users do not wish to simply plod along when they go out, and prefer an option that has a decent rate of speed. The speed of a scooter could also determine how far it can travel on one charge.

Consider a folding model if you need a mobility scooter that is easy to transport and portable. Many of the new models on the market can be easily dismantled and put in the trunk of a car which makes them a great option for commuters. Some models come with built-in handles, making them more compact.

When determining the weight of a scooter, you must also consider the condition of the vehicle. If a vehicle is stored in garages, its tires may be flattened. This will increase the weight. A flat tire can also cause instability and negatively affect the performance of a scooter.

You should also think about the payment method for your mobility scooter. Certain insurance companies will cover some or all of the cost of a mobility scooter if you can prove it is medically necessary. It is crucial to evaluate the various options prior to making the purchase. Some retailers will offer financing and a low price guarantee so that you can be certain that you are getting the best price possible.

Battery life

The battery life of an average mobility scooter depends upon several aspects, including the kind and frequency of usage of the battery. The battery should last for up to three years. If you take your scooter for long distances often, the battery could be depleted faster than you expected. In this case, you should consider getting new batteries.

You can also extend the battery's life by charging it daily. This is an essential aspect of maintaining the battery of a mobility scooter as it decreases the depth of each discharge and recharge cycle. It is crucial to avoid a deeper discharge because it could reduce the battery's lifespan. It is recommended not to use any aftermarket chargers because they can harm batteries.

It is also recommended to use a smart charger when charging your mobility scooter. This charger will allow you to keep track of the condition of your battery, and keep it from being overcharged or discharged. It is also a good idea to use an insulated storage location for your battery. Many manufacturers provide strict instructions regarding how to store the batteries.

Typically mobility scooter batteries come in a variety of types: lithium, GEL, and AGM (Absorbent Glass Mat). All of them are a kind of Sealed Lead Acid or SLA battery, they each have distinct strengths and weaknesses. Generally speaking, the manufacturer of the scooter will choose the right type of battery for the specific model it's producing.

The size and power of the motor of a mobility scooter impacts its lifespan. A powerful motor will drain batteries quicker than a smaller one. The battery will also be depleted faster if you drive your scooter at high speeds.

Most manufacturers include a warranty on their products. If you're not sure of the terms of the warranty, you should contact the customer service representative of the company to learn more. Before buying a device for mobility it is crucial to thoroughly read the warranty conditions. It is crucial to understand the return policy of the manufacturer. This will help you make the right decision when you decide to purchase the latest model or sell an old one.

Safety

A typical electric scooter comprises a seat that sits over two rear wheels, a flat surface for the rider's feet, and handlebars to steer. The controls are located in the middle of the device, and function as an steering wheel on bicycles. There are levers above the main handles to tell the scooter if it is to go forward or reverse. Some models allow you to change direction using the levers. Most users find that once they are used to the controls, operating a scooter is relatively simple.

When looking for an where buy electric mobility scooters near scooter, be sure you think about the amount of storage you need. Mobility scooters aren't only designed to transport you. They can also be used to carry the usual cargo that people take with them to do local errands or to visit friends. Therefore, you'll need to choose a model with ample storage space that can accommodate your groceries or personal effects.

You'll also need to select a scooter that is able to navigate through a variety of terrain. A four-wheeled mobility scooter will give you better stability and traction when you plan to use it on grass or snow. Also that, if you intend to use your scooter for long distances, it's best place to buy mobility scooter to select a model with a an extra battery and motor that can accommodate your weight.

Visibility is a further aspect to take into consideration. The bright shade on many scooters that sparkles in the sun may not be enough to make you visible especially at night. Consider adding LED or intelligent strips of lights to your scooter to increase visibility.

Try your scooter in various scenarios once you've found the best one for your needs. This will help you gain an understanding of its speed and maneuverability, and ensure that it's safe to drive in all environments.
